Implementasi CI/CD Pada Microservices Untuk Meningkatkan Availability Pada Pemrosesan Big Data

  • Kompiang Gede Sukadharma Universitas Udayana
  • I Putu Gede Hendra Suputra Universitas Udayana
##plugins.pubIds.doi.readerDisplayName## https://doi.org/10.24843/JLK.2023.v12.i03.p12

Abstrak

Big Data Processing needed a reliable system that not let the data loss. But sometimes we need to make the system down for a while because we need to push the newest changes of the system. The automation will help us achieve that. Continuous Integration and Continuous Deployment help us to reduce the downtime and increase the availability of the system. Thus, the implication will be led to reduce of data loss. This research focusses on the implementation of CI/CD Pipeline on single-point-of-failure service on Microservices Architecture. This research use Load-Testing to measure data loss on certain amount of time. The result on this research show that implementing CI/CD Pipeline on the Microservices that we made, make the down time will be less than 45 Second with 20 Virtual user who send the data.

##plugins.generic.usageStats.downloads##

##plugins.generic.usageStats.noStats##
Diterbitkan
2024-01-23
##submission.howToCite##
SUKADHARMA, Kompiang Gede; SUPUTRA, I Putu Gede Hendra. Implementasi CI/CD Pada Microservices Untuk Meningkatkan Availability Pada Pemrosesan Big Data. JELIKU (Jurnal Elektronik Ilmu Komputer Udayana), [S.l.], v. 12, n. 3, p. 597-604, jan. 2024. ISSN 2654-5101. Tersedia pada: <https://ojs.unud.ac.id/index.php/jlk/article/view/92711>. Tanggal Akses: 25 apr. 2025 doi: https://doi.org/10.24843/JLK.2023.v12.i03.p12.

##plugins.generic.recommendByAuthor.heading##